A block grabber script, often used in the context of Amazon Flex, is an automated tool designed to give users a competitive edge in securing desirable delivery blocks within the Amazon Flex app. Delivery blocks are time slots during which drivers make deliveries and are compensated by Amazon. The availability of these blocks is often limited, and drivers may compete to secure the most profitable ones.
The purpose of a block grabber script is to monitor the Amazon Flex app for newly released blocks and automatically accept them on behalf of the user based on their predefined preferences, such as location, duration, and compensation. By automating this process, the script can significantly increase a driver's chances of obtaining lucrative delivery blocks, as it can act faster than a human user manually refreshing and accepting blocks.
A block grabber script typically works by continuously refreshing the offers page in the Amazon Flex app, scanning for new blocks that meet the user's criteria. Once a suitable block is detected, the script attempts to accept the block on behalf of the user, often at a speed that surpasses human capabilities. To avoid detection by Amazon's security systems, these scripts may also incorporate stealth features, such as mimicking human-like behavior, randomizing click patterns, and introducing variable delays between actions.
Some features can be:
Rapid block refreshing: The script continuously refreshes the block offers page to ensure that new blocks are detected as soon as they become available.
Customizable block filters: Users can define preferences for specific blocks, such as location, time, or payment, so the script only grabs blocks that meet the desired criteria.
Auto-acceptance: The script can automatically accept blocks that match the defined preferences, saving the user time and increasing the chances of securing desirable blocks.
Adjustable refresh rate: Users can set the refresh rate to balance the need for speed with the risk of getting detected by Amazon's anti-bot measures.
Notification system: The script can send notifications via email or text message when a block has been successfully grabbed or if any issues arise.
Stealth mode: The script can mimic human-like behavior to avoid detection by Amazon's security systems, such as randomizing click patterns and introducing delays between actions.
